A conditional field is a field that is hidden from the respondent's view by default. Once triggered by a multiple choice option, it is visible on the form. ... To create a conditional field, you must have a multiple-choice field to trigger it. Conditional fields cannot be triggered by text input questions.

The first conditional is used when an outcome is likely or possible, and the main clause is usually formed with will + base verb. If no one answers, please call back tomorrow. Should no one answer, please call back tomorrow.
